p@rdalys provides the full configuration set for the Kolab Server (http://www.kolab.org) and is based on puppet (http://reductivelabs.com/trac/puppet). Besides the configuration data it provides Ruby extensions to puppet.
RAGUI is a Ruby on Rails based package for managing an Asterisk(tm) PBX in real time mode. Support for extension provisioning, queues, customized scripting and reporting are provided with the system.
RuBiBoB is a command line client, written in Ruby with SOAP4r and highline, for BiBoB's SOAP service, it enables you to send sms' and check your balance of your BiBoB account.

MOR is Billing System for Asterisk PBX. It supports postpaid/prepaid billing with LCR and Fail-Over. Realtime Asterisk management using web interface. Reporting and advanced rating. Based on fast C application for Asterisk and Ruby On Rails GUI.

Spamato is a spam filter system that combines several anti-spam techniques, from which thousands of users benefit. It is available as an add-on for Thunderbird and Outlook, and as a stand-alone proxy for other email clients. IMAP and POP are supported.
uCast is a web-based system that allows users to publish, browse, and subscribe to podcasts. This software was developed at, and thus is targeted for use at, a higher education institution. Also: shared podcast control, file re-utilization, aliases.

Forsythia is an open source weblog publishing platform. The platform supports RSS and Atom feeds, rich-text editing, customizable themes, comments, trackbacks, pingbacks and an XML-RPC interface.
